Output 7f66854953ae10df3d68a7c2c927c133e5ef6b6c13ca5b1eb3a36ed7fdcf88d0:1

value
32621183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6833191beebec8081d39944a12f1ce4df09de31 OP_EQUAL
address
3JL44x4TCmUYPsjK1SQWao8RwfVbdurn8n
transaction
7f66854953ae10df3d68a7c2c927c133e5ef6b6c13ca5b1eb3a36ed7fdcf88d0
spent
true